First edition and the first printing of the plates. Plate volume only. Bradel binding of marbled paper boards by T. Boichot, preserved covers repaired and laid down. This copy retains its 18 plates mounted on guards, but lacks the title page, showing details of the work undertaken to remove the western obelisk at Luxor, as well as various sites and costumes in Egypt linked to the places visited by the expedition. Tiny wormtracks occasionally affecting some engravings, dampstain to upper margin, traces of sewing to inner margin. Very rare.
